Wood Siding Staining in Waco, TX
Wood siding staining services involve applying protective and decorative finishes to exterior wooden surfaces on residential properties. This process enhances the appearance of the siding, bringing out the natural beauty of the wood grain, while also providing a barrier against weather elements such as moisture, sun exposure, and temperature fluctuations. Projects typically include restoring or maintaining existing wood siding, as well as preparing new installations for long-lasting beauty and durability. Property owners often seek this service to improve curb appeal, extend the lifespan of their siding, and ensure their home remains well-protected against the elements.
Before requesting wood siding staining, homeowners usually want to understand the condition of their existing siding, including whether it requires cleaning, sanding, or repairs prior to staining. It’s also important to consider the type of stain or finish best suited for the specific wood species and climate conditions. Proper preparation and application techniques are essential for achieving a uniform, long-lasting finish. Property owners should inquire about the available stain options, maintenance requirements, and the expected durability of the stain to make informed decisions about their siding’s appearance and protection.

Wood Siding Staining Questions
What is wood siding staining? Wood siding staining involves applying a protective finish to enhance appearance and extend the lifespan of the siding.
How often should wood siding be stained? Typically, wood siding should be stained every 3 to 5 years to maintain its look and protection.
What types of stains are available for wood siding? There are transparent, semi-transparent, and solid stains, each offering different levels of color and protection.
Can staining help improve the appearance of weathered wood siding? Yes, staining can refresh weathered wood, restoring color and providing a protective barrier against the elements.
